Block

#21,775,413
Block Number
21,775,413 @ 05/26/2025, 18:15:50
Status
Finalized
ID
0x014c4435e587aef3770bf3988eab9c6f9eacde70995582d9701c534dde6f13c4
Transactions
Gas Used
10655560/39960938 (26.66% Used)
Total Score
2,126,652,216 (+98)
Rewards
43.56 VTHO